Replit in 2026 is no longer just an online IDE or browser-based compiler. It has evolved into an agent-first AI development platform where developers can describe an app in natural language and watch it get built, debugged, and deployed automatically. This shift places the platform at the center of the fast-growing vibe coding movement, where intent matters more than syntax.

At its core, Replit bridges the gap between traditional coding tools and no-code platforms. It provides real code, real infrastructure, and autonomous AI agents inside a single cloud workspace.

What Is This Platform in 2026?

This environment is best described as an agentic AI development system. Instead of starting with empty files and complex setup, users begin with a clear description of what they want to build.

It can:

  • Generate full-stack applications from prompts
  • Design backend APIs and frontends together
  • Fix errors automatically during runtime
  • Deploy apps instantly with built-in hosting

This makes it especially useful for students, indie hackers, and startups that need speed without heavy DevOps work.


Agent vs Assistant

One common source of confusion is the difference between the two AI modes available.

Agent

  • Builds entire applications end-to-end
  • Creates file structure, frameworks, and logic
  • Ideal for MVPs, dashboards, and SaaS prototypes

Assistant

  • Works inside existing code
  • Explains, refactors, and fixes specific functions
  • Ideal for debugging and learning

In simple terms, the Agent creates, while the Assistant improves.


The Vibe Coding Workflow

Vibe coding follows a natural three-step flow.

1. Describe the App

You start with a clear requirement, such as:
“Build a full-stack task manager with login, dashboard, and dark mode.”

The AI interprets this and generates the complete project.

2. Iterate Using Prompts

Instead of manual debugging, you guide the system:

  • Fix authentication errors
  • Improve UI layout
  • Optimize API performance

The updates are applied directly to the codebase.

3. Deploy Instantly

Using built-in autoscaling and deployment tools, apps can go live with:

  • Production URLs
  • Environment variables
  • Optional custom domains

This workflow is why the platform is often compared with Cursor, Lovable, and GitHub Codespaces.


Is It Production-Ready?

The platform is production-ready for many modern use cases, with clear strengths and limits.

Advantages

  • Zero configuration setup
  • Real-time collaboration (multiplayer mode)
  • Fast prototyping and iteration
  • Integrated deployment and hosting

Limitations

  • AI credit usage can become expensive
  • Not ideal for very large datasets
  • Some advanced agent features are still evolving

For MVPs, internal tools, and early-stage products, it performs exceptionally well.

Common Questions

Can the Agent build mobile apps?
Primarily web apps. Mobile apps require wrappers or external frameworks.

Can I deploy to a custom domain?
Yes, directly from the deployment dashboard.

Do I need both Agent and Assistant?
Yes. One builds, the other refines.
